## Authentication

Heads up: the nightly reindex job (`reindex_nightly.py`) talks to the Lanternfish search cluster, and that cluster won't accept anonymous writes anymore — we locked it down last sprint. The job now authenticates as the `reindex-runner` service identity against Corvid Gateway, and the token is injected via the `LF_INDEX_TOKEN` env var in the scheduler config. Nothing clever going on, just a bearer header on every batch request. For review purposes, the staging credential currently in use is listed below.

service key, kadug-kadup: kto15_rN23XLAYImmZgrJ

For the finance team. The Marrowfield group policy with Tellan Assurance renews at quarter-end. Quoted premium rises 11% on property lines, driven by the Dunmere warehouse revaluation; liability terms are unchanged. Alternatives from Corvane Mutual came in higher with weaker flood cover. Recommendation is to renew with Tellan, accept the higher deductible on the Ashfell site, and revisit brokerage next year. Budget impact is already reflected in the draft forecast. Context on forward plans is noted below.

management briefing: Only 34 of the 227 pilot accounts renewed Julath, so a churn review is set for December 28. Jorwynox Foods is in early talks to buy Silirix Freight for about $241.8 million.

Subject: Quickstore 4.2 — bloom filter now fronts the KV layer

Plugin authors: starting with this release, Quickstore places a bloom filter ahead of the key-value store. Negative lookups return faster; false positives fall through safely. No API changes are required on your side. Verify your plugin against the staging build referenced below.

session token of fahif-tadup = htk3_9c7

## Formula sandbox tuning

User-supplied formulas in Gridmoor execute inside a restricted interpreter with hard ceilings on time, memory, and call depth. Reviewers should confirm any change to these ceilings is justified in the PR description, since raising them widens the abuse surface. Defaults were chosen from production traces. The current limits are as follows.

limits module of tafog-fawip:
WEIGHTS = {
    "julix": 57,
    "lamys": 992,
    "kasvan": 209,
    "quenok": 750,
    "alddor": 259,
    "oliath": 1009,
    "wenix": 815,
}